Deutschlandfunk (DLF)

Deutschlandfunk, or DLF as it's often called, is one of the most respected public radio stations in Germany. Think of it as the German equivalent of NPR or the BBC. It’s known for its high-quality journalism, in-depth reporting, and comprehensive coverage of national and international news. DLF offers a wide range of programs, including news bulletins, interviews, features, and cultural programs. The station places a strong emphasis on factual accuracy and balanced reporting, making it a reliable source of information. The language used is generally clear and articulate, which is great for language learners. It covers a broad spectrum of topics, including politics, business, culture, science, and sports. This comprehensive approach ensures that listeners get a well-rounded view of current events and important issues. DLF's website and app provide live streams and on-demand audio, making it easy to listen from anywhere in the world. The station also produces podcasts and special features, allowing you to dive deeper into specific topics of interest. Regular news bulletins are broadcast throughout the day, providing up-to-the-minute updates on breaking stories. These bulletins are concise and informative, ensuring you stay informed without having to listen for hours. Plus, DLF often hosts live discussions and debates on current issues, featuring experts and policymakers. These discussions offer valuable insights and different perspectives, encouraging critical thinking and a deeper understanding of the topics at hand.

WDR 5

WDR 5 is another fantastic public radio station, part of the Westdeutscher Rundfunk (WDR) network. It's super popular, especially in North Rhine-Westphalia, but you can listen to it online from anywhere. WDR 5 is known for its mix of news, cultural programs, and discussions. It’s a great station if you want more than just headlines – they really dive into the stories. The station offers a diverse range of programs, including news magazines, cultural shows, and in-depth interviews. This variety ensures that there is something for everyone, whether you are interested in politics, arts, or social issues. WDR 5 places a strong emphasis on providing context and background information, helping listeners understand the complexities of current events. The station often features reports and analyses that go beyond the surface, offering a more nuanced perspective. Regular news broadcasts keep you informed throughout the day, with updates on local, national, and international news. The station also provides traffic updates and weather forecasts, which are particularly useful for listeners in North Rhine-Westphalia. Plus, WDR 5 hosts a variety of cultural programs, including book reviews, theater performances, and music shows. These programs offer a glimpse into the vibrant cultural scene in Germany and beyond. The station’s website and app make it easy to access live streams and on-demand content. You can listen to your favorite programs whenever and wherever you want, making it a convenient way to stay informed and entertained.

Deutschlandfunk Kultur

Deutschlandfunk Kultur, closely related to Deutschlandfunk, focuses more on culture and the arts but also includes news and current affairs. If you're into literature, music, theater, and all things cultural, this is your go-to station. It provides a unique blend of news and cultural programming. The station’s coverage of the arts is extensive, featuring reviews, interviews, and live performances. This makes it a great resource for anyone interested in German and international culture. Deutschlandfunk Kultur also offers in-depth news coverage, with a focus on the cultural and social aspects of current events. This provides a unique perspective that you won’t find on other news stations. The station’s language is often sophisticated and articulate, making it a good choice for advanced German learners. Listening to Deutschlandfunk Kultur can help you expand your vocabulary and improve your understanding of complex topics. Regular news broadcasts keep you informed of the latest headlines, with a particular emphasis on cultural and social issues. The station also features discussions and debates on topics related to the arts, literature, and music. N-JOY

N-JOY is a youth-oriented radio station that is part of the Norddeutscher Rundfunk (NDR) network. While it's not exclusively a news station, it does provide news updates and covers current events in a way that appeals to younger audiences. N-JOY is known for its mix of music, entertainment, and news. It's a great option if you want to stay informed without feeling like you're listening to a lecture. The station’s news coverage is tailored to the interests of young people, focusing on topics such as social media, technology, and youth culture. This makes it a relevant and engaging source of information for younger listeners. N-JOY also provides regular updates on current events, with a focus on the issues that matter most to young people. The station’s language is casual and accessible, making it easy for non-native speakers to understand. Listening to N-JOY can help you improve your German language skills while staying up-to-date on current events. How to Listen

Okay, so now you know about some awesome German news radio stations. But how do you actually listen to them? Here are a few options:

  • Online Streaming: Most of these stations have live streams available on their websites. Just head to their site and click the play button!
  • Radio Apps: There are tons of radio apps out there (like TuneIn Radio) that let you search for and stream radio stations from all over the world. Super convenient!
  • DAB+: If you're in Germany, you can often pick up these stations on DAB+ (Digital Audio Broadcasting). It's like digital radio – clearer sound and more stations!

Tips for Language Learners

If you're using these radio stations to improve your German, here are a few tips:

  • Start Simple: Don't jump straight into the super complex political debates. Start with shorter news bulletins and work your way up.
  • Take Notes: Jot down new words and phrases you hear. Look them up later and try to use them in your own conversations.
  • Listen Regularly: The more you listen, the better you'll get! Try to make it a daily habit, even if it's just for 15-20 minutes.
